Justin Tucker’s Biography
Justin Tucker was born in Houston, Texas on November 21, 1989. He attended the University of Texas at Austin, where he was a member of the Longhorns football team and was named an All-American in 2011. After college, he went undrafted in the 2012 NFL Draft, but signed with the Baltimore Ravens after a tryout.
Since joining the Ravens, Tucker has become one of the league’s most consistent kickers. He has earned Pro Bowl and All-Pro honors and holds the NFL record for most career field goals of 50 yards or longer.
